Skip to content

Commit 01a56bf

Browse files
author
Lap Ming Lee
committed
upgrade dependencies
1 parent 00a266c commit 01a56bf

File tree

5 files changed

+18
-15
lines changed

5 files changed

+18
-15
lines changed

dart/lib/src/noop_client.dart

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import 'dart:async';
2-
import 'dart:typed_data';
32
import 'dart:convert';
3+
import 'dart:typed_data';
4+
45
import 'package:http/http.dart';
56

67
class NoOpClient implements Client {
@@ -22,7 +23,9 @@ class NoOpClient implements Client {
2223
void close() {}
2324

2425
@override
25-
Future<Response> delete(url, {Map<String, String> headers}) => _response;
26+
Future<Response> delete(Uri url,
27+
{Map<String, String> headers, Object body, Encoding encoding}) =>
28+
_response;
2629

2730
@override
2831
Future<Response> get(url, {Map<String, String> headers}) => _response;

dart/lib/src/transport/http_transport.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-53,7 +53,7 @@ class HttpTransport implements Transport {
5353
);
5454

5555
final response = await _options.httpClient.post(
56-
_dsn.postUri,
56+
Uri.parse(_dsn.postUri),
5757
headers: _credentialBuilder.configure(_headers),
5858
body: body,
5959
);

dart/pubspec.yaml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-10,10 +10,10 @@ environment:
1010
sdk: ">=2.8.0 <3.0.0"
1111

1212
dependencies:
13-
http: ^0.12.0
14-
meta: ^1.0.0
15-
stack_trace: ^1.0.0
16-
uuid: ^2.0.0
13+
http: ^0.13.0
14+
meta: ^1.3.0
15+
stack_trace: ^1.10.0
16+
uuid: ^3.0.0
1717

1818
dev_dependencies:
1919
mockito: ^4.1.3

dart/test/http_client/sentry_http_client_test.dart

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 void main() {
2121

2222
final client = SentryHttpClient(client: mockClient, hub: mockHub);
2323

24-
final response = await client.get('https://example.com');
24+
final response = await client.get(Uri.parse('https://example.com'));
2525
expect(response.statusCode, 200);
2626

2727
final breadcrumb = verify(mockHub.addBreadcrumb(captureAny))
@@ -47,7 +47,7 @@ void main() {
4747

4848
final client = SentryHttpClient(client: mockClient, hub: mockHub);
4949

50-
final response = await client.get('https://example.com');
50+
final response = await client.get(Uri.parse('https://example.com'));
5151
expect(response.statusCode, 404);
5252

5353
final breadcrumb = verify(mockHub.addBreadcrumb(captureAny))
@@ -73,7 +73,7 @@ void main() {
7373

7474
final client = SentryHttpClient(client: mockClient, hub: mockHub);
7575

76-
final response = await client.post('https://example.com');
76+
final response = await client.post(Uri.parse('https://example.com'));
7777
expect(response.statusCode, 200);
7878

7979
final breadcrumb = verify(mockHub.addBreadcrumb(captureAny))
@@ -98,7 +98,7 @@ void main() {
9898

9999
final client = SentryHttpClient(client: mockClient, hub: mockHub);
100100

101-
final response = await client.put('https://example.com');
101+
final response = await client.put(Uri.parse('https://example.com'));
102102
expect(response.statusCode, 200);
103103

104104
final breadcrumb = verify(mockHub.addBreadcrumb(captureAny))
@@ -123,7 +123,7 @@ void main() {
123123

124124
final client = SentryHttpClient(client: mockClient, hub: mockHub);
125125

126-
final response = await client.delete('https://example.com');
126+
final response = await client.delete(Uri.parse('https://example.com'));
127127
expect(response.statusCode, 200);
128128

129129
final breadcrumb = verify(mockHub.addBreadcrumb(captureAny))
@@ -156,7 +156,7 @@ void main() {
156156
final client = SentryHttpClient(client: mockClient, hub: mockHub);
157157

158158
try {
159-
await client.get('https://example.com');
159+
await client.get(Uri.parse('https://example.com'));
160160
fail('Method did not throw');
161161
} on ClientException catch (e) {
162162
expect(e.message, 'test');
@@ -182,7 +182,7 @@ void main() {
182182
final client = SentryHttpClient(client: mockClient, hub: mockHub);
183183

184184
try {
185-
await client.get('https://example.com');
185+
await client.get(Uri.parse('https://example.com'));
186186
fail('Method did not throw');
187187
} on SocketException catch (e) {
188188
expect(e.message, 'test');

flutter/pubspec.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 dependencies:
1414
flutter_web_plugins:
1515
sdk: flutter
1616
sentry: ">=4.0.0 <5.0.0"
17-
package_info: ^0.4.0
17+
package_info: ^2.0.0
1818

1919
dev_dependencies:
2020
flutter_test:

0 commit comments

Comments
 (0)